>
Dersin Adı Dersin Kodu Dersin Türü Dersin Düzeyi Dersin Yılı Dersin Verildiği Dönem AKTS Kredisi
İşlemci Programlama Yöntemleri EEP220 Seçmeli Önlisans 2 Bahar 3

Öğretim Elemanı Adı

Öğr. Gör. Ümmühan AKHİSAR
Öğr. Gör. Rauf YALÇIN

Dersin Öğrenme Kazanımları

1) Bir Programlama dilinin temel kavramlarını açıklar.
2) C, Pascal, Basic vb bir programlama dilinde yazılım yapar.
3) Verilen bir elektronik tasarım projesinde Sistemin gereksinimlerini tesbit eder
4) Sistemin algoritmasını oluşturur.
5) Programın akış diyagramını ve Yazılımın kodlarını tesbit eder.

Program Yeterliliği İlişkisi

  Program Yeterlilikleri
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18
Öğrenme Kazanımları
1             Yüksek                      
2             Yüksek                      
3             Yüksek                     Düşük
4     Düşük       Yüksek                      
5     Düşük       Yüksek                      

Eğitim Şekli

Yüz Yüze

Ön Koşullar, Diğer Koşullar

Yok

Önerilen Destekleyici Dersler

Yok

Dersin İçeriği

Programlamanın Temel Kavramları. Mikroişlemcinin Temel Yapısı ve Programlama Dilinin Temel Kavramları. Programlama. CSC C, PICBASIC, JAL v.b. Gibi Dillerde Tanımak. Problem Çözme Yöntemleri. Verilen Bir Problemin Çözüm Aşamalarında İzlenecek Adımlar, Durum Diyagramları, Geçiş Diyagramları ve Tabloları, Programın Kısıtlamaları. Sistem Tasarımı. İstenilen Bir Sistemin Donanım ve Yazılım Olarak Tasarlanması Sırasında İzlenecek Adımlar.

Haftalık Ders İzlencesi

1) Programlama dilinde kullanılan operatörler
2) Fonksiyon yazımı
3) Zamanlayıcıları denetleyen program , Portlardan veri okuyan program , Portlara veri yazan program, Kesme uyarmalı Giriş/Çıkış program yazımı
4) Zamanlayıcıları denetleyen program , Portlardan veri okuyan program , Portlara veri yazan program Kesme uyarmalı Giriş/Çıkış programların çalıştırılması
5) 7 elemanlı göstergeyi denetleyen program , Dot matrix göstergeyi denetleyen program , LCD göstergeyi denetleyen program yazılımı
6) 7 elemanlı göstergeyi denetleyen program , Dot matrix göstergeyi denetleyen program , LCD göstergeyi denetleyen programların çalıştırılması.
7) Adım motorunu denetleyen program yazımı ve çalıştırılması
8) Ara sınav/Değerlendirme
9) Analog-Digital çevirici ve Digital-Analog çevirici Programları
10) Durum diyagramı, kullanım nedeni
11) Bir elektronik tasarım projesinin belirlenmes
12) Bir problem için geçiş diyagramı çizimi ve durum tablosunun yazımı.
13) Verilen bir elektronik tasarım projesinin gereksinimlerini belirler Sistemin özelliklerinin açıklanması.
14) Yazılımın modüler yapısı, sistemin algoritması
15) Programın akış diyagramı, yazılımın kodları
16) Yarıyıl sonu sınavı

Önerilen/İstenen Ders Kaynakları

Planlanan Öğrenim Faaliyetleri Ve Eğitim Yöntemi

1) Anlatım
2) Soru-Cevap
3) Tartışma
4) Alıştırma ve Uygulama
5) Laboratuvar/Çalıştay


Değerlendirme Yöntemi ve Ölçütleri

Yarıyıl İçi Çalışmalarının Başarıya Oranı

40%

 

Sayı

Yüzde

Yarıyıl İçi Çalışmaları

Ara Sınav

1

60%

Uygulama

1

40%

 

Yarıyıl Sonu Sınavının Başarıya Oranı

60%

Toplam

100%

Dersin Eğitim Dili

Türkçe

Mesleki Uygulama

İstenmemekte